Best Graphic Design Schools in Oregon

The field of graphic design is considered a branch of other visual communication fields – graphic designers use a combination of artistic and technical methods to assemble and manipulate words, symbols, and images in order to produce a visual representation of ideas print and digital channels. Graphic designers use their skills in a variety of fields, including publishing, advertising, entertainment, and education.

As such, graphic design programs integrate practice, theory, and inquiry while refining students’ vision, critical thinking, and communication skills. The colleges we’ve listed below have proven their excellence in academics and continue to offer the very best in art education.

Graphic Designer Salary in Oregon

Students who complete a graphic design major graduate with a ability that is very much in demand by employers in many fields. Often however, these new graduates face strong competition for graphic design jobs due to the many talented individuals that apply for graphic design position.

Current data from Careerinfonet.org indicates that the employment outlook for the field is definitely favorable. Graphic design employment in the state of Oregon is very favorable and poised to increase by 19% or by 120 jobs every year from now until 2020. These new jobs are classified by Careerinfonet.org as ‘new growth’.
